#68b75e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#68b75e is composed of 40.8% red, 71.8%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 48.6% yellow and 28.2% black. It has a hue angle of 113.3 degrees, a saturation of 38.2% and a lightness of 54.3%. #68b75e color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ffbc with #006f00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#68b75e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010201 is the darkest color, while #f4faf3 is the lightest one.
